Located within Ise-Shima National Park in Mie Prefecture, Japan, Kashikojima Hojoen is a beloved traditional Japanese hot spring resort. Nestled along the scenic shores of Ago Bay, the hotel offers all guest rooms with ocean views, allowing you to enjoy the serene beauty of the sea and sky right from your room. The hotel features open-air natural hot spring baths rich in minerals, which help relieve fatigue and promote wellness and beauty. For dinner, guests are served authentic Japanese kaiseki cuisine, with seasonal dishes featuring fresh local delicacies such as Ise lobster and abalone for an exquisite dining experience. Conveniently located, the hotel provides complimentary shuttle service from Kintetsu Kashikojima Station, just a 3-minute ride away—making it an ideal destination for families, couples, and elderly travelers. At Amanemu the ancient Japanese tradition of onsen - mineral hot springs - is ever present. Each of the 24 Suites features an expansive deck and a private plunge bath supplied with nutrient rich spring water while the Aman Spa offers outdoor bathing pavilions. There are also four two-bedroom Villas. Set in Ise Shima National Park on Japans Kii Peninsula the resort overlooks Ago Bay known as the Bay of Pearls. Ancient pilgrimage routes wind through nearby forests and Japans most sacred Shinto shrines are within easy reach. Guided by a classical Japanese aesthetic Amanemus Suites and Villas are replete with natural materials and large glass windows with woven textile and timber sliding shutters that open to embrace the natural surroundings. Amanemu embraces the ancient Japanese bathing tradition of onsen using nutrient-rich thermal springs to provide a contemplative and restorative retreat set among serene natural surroundings of the onsen spa. Japanese cuisine at The Restaurant uses local produce including fresh seafood and the renowned Matsusaka Wagyu beef.
